On February 13, Salford City Council made a significant decision to acquire complete ownership of the Salford Community Stadium. This move is expected to have far-reaching implications for the city’s sports and leisure landscape, as well as contribute to the regeneration of the surrounding area.

By assuming full ownership of the stadium, the council gains complete control over its operations and assets. This decision marks a pivotal moment in the stadium’s history and underscores the council’s commitment to supporting sporting endeavors within the community.

The acquisition of the Salford Community Stadium aligns with the council’s broader goals of enhancing recreational opportunities and fostering community engagement. With full ownership, the council will have greater flexibility in managing the stadium’s facilities and organizing various sporting events and activities.

Furthermore, the move is expected to bolster the fortunes of the Red Devils, a prominent rugby team based in Salford. The stadium serves as their home ground, and the council’s ownership will likely lead to improved facilities and resources for the team. This development is poised to inject renewed enthusiasm and optimism into the local rugby community.

Moreover, the acquisition of the stadium is anticipated to stimulate economic growth and urban development in the surrounding area. As a focal point for sports and entertainment, the stadium has the potential to attract visitors and investment, thereby revitalizing the neighborhood and creating new opportunities for residents.

Overall, the decision by Salford City Council to take full ownership of the Salford Community Stadium represents a significant milestone for the city’s sporting landscape. It signals a commitment to promoting physical activity, supporting local teams, and driving sustainable development in the community.
